Responsibilities

-Product Design/Ownership

-Designing FPGA/CPU Based products in a variety of form factors including 3U/6U VPX and PCIe.

-Keeping up to date on the latest industry technology and how to apply it

-Guiding a product from conception to production

-Providing consistency across products in a given product line

-Digital Circuit Design including:

  • Xilinx and Intel FPGA schematics
  • Xilinx and Intel Processor Schematics including MPSoC/x86
  • Clock Distribution and Synchronization
  • Low-Speed Serial Protocols such as i2c and SPI
  • High-Speed Serial Protocols such as Ethernet (1GbE, 10GbE, 100GbE, etc.), PCIe, Infiniband, Serial Rapid IO (SRIO), JESD204x
  • Power Supply design
  • Optical Interfaces
  • High-Speed Storage Interfaces

-Research on new technologies and devices to utilize in Annapolis' Product Line

-Product Definition, Design, Verification & Validation

-Assist in Defining Product Requirements

-Generate Product Specifications

-Develop Prototype Plans

-Perform Design Validation of Prototype Circuits as well as new full design in the laboratory

-Operate in a team environment to develop COTS solutions designed with the end-user in mind

-Generate documentation to enable our Firmware and Software Teams to produce software to enable and test your design's hardware functionality

Company DescriptionAnnapolis Micro Systems, Inc. was founded in 1982 as a center of excellence in electronics research and design. Since then, we have developed a full WILDTM EcoSystem of boards and systems and software. These high-performance FPGA-based products are utilized by some of the biggest names in the defense, aerospace and commercial sectors. Our products are deployed all around the world on naval ships (signals intelligence), radar stations (signal processing), and on reconnaissance flights (synthetic aperture radar). Our bleeding-edge technology pushes the limits of what is possible in both the electrical and mechanical realms.
